Tria Technologies to Bring Qualcomm Dragonwing IQ-6 Series to Market with Two New Compute Modules

­Tria Technologies, an Avnet company specializing in the manufacturing of embedded compute boards, has introduced the TRIA SM2S-IQ615 and TRIA OSM-LF-IQ-615 modules, marking commercial availability of computer-on-module (COM) worldwide featuring a Qualcomm Dragonwing™ IQ-615 processor. The modules provide AI-ready industrial-grade performance and robust peripheral support within a power-efficient and developer-friendly design, enabling developers and engineers to push the boundaries in edge AI.

Both the SM2S-IQ615 SMARC (Smart Mobility ARChitecture) module and TRIA OSM-LF-IQ615 (Open Standard Module) feature the Dragonwing IQ-615 Processor and integrate Qualcomm® Kryo™ Gen 4 CPU with a 64-bit Octa-Core processor and a powerful Qualcomm® Adreno™ 612 GPU, bringing performance and energy efficiency to Linux-based edge applications. The Qualcomm® Hexagon™ V66 DSP with Dual Hexagon Vector, enables developers to create more capable, cost-effective, and energy-efficient machine learning (ML) applications.

Developers can now begin projects with the Dragonwing IQ6 Series in earnest, from developing and optimizing software for the Dragonwing IQ-615 or AI model tuning, to conducting real-world performance testing, benchmarking, and validation. Both modules feature Yocto Linux BSP as standard, with Ubuntu Linux OS support also available on request.

Developers can also benefit from advanced security features including Secure boot, secure debug, TrustZone and Qualcomm® Trusted Execution Environment and hardware supported KeyStore. Additionally, both modules provide fast and low power LPDDR4 memory technology, combined with up to 256GB eMMC Flash memory.

An extensive set of interfaces for embedded applications are available, such as Dual Gigabit Ethernet, PCI Express Gen. 2, USB 2.0/3.1, DP v1.4, MIPI-DSI, LVDS, and up to 3x MIPI CSI-2 for connecting cameras. This makes it ideal for embedded vision, machine learning, and multimedia applications. 

Both modules are available with development kits and board support packages to accelerate integration and prototyping.

The SM2S-IQ615 module is compliant with the SMARC 2.2 standard, allowing easy integration with SMARC baseboards, and the OSM-LF-IQ615 module is compliant with the OSM 1.2 standard (OSM-SL).

SMARC is one of the best and most future-proof standards for small form factor embedded designs, ideal for products that require compact embedded computing without compromising on processing capability.

OSMs are designed to provide the smallest possible form factor with a focus on versatility. For a growing number of IoT applications, this standard helps to combine the advantages of modular embedded computing with the increasing demands on cost, space, and interfaces.
